Output 84e81580c38bf947c0572ce25c8a0ae2e011cb741f0fa087c54aebf32d3c8b2a:0

value
25327980960
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5789b319a084a4867980b7be57da8f7536a45b45 OP_EQUALVERIFY OP_CHECKSIG
address
DD7xHV3TDawt1h7XjhmJfShrnUnj3h3Net
transaction
84e81580c38bf947c0572ce25c8a0ae2e011cb741f0fa087c54aebf32d3c8b2a